Is Ed Reed the best safety ever?

I

Ed Reed is one of the Greatest Safeties ever to play the Game he has the most return yards for interceptions and he helped the Ravens to win 2 super bowls. He has over 60 interceptions 10 Forced Fumbles, 4 blocked punts, 13 total touchdowns, and 6 sacks. He is one of the most complete safeties ever to play the game.

Furthermore, Who has more interceptions Troy Polamalu or Ed Reed?
Reed currently has 54 Interceptions against Polamalu’s 27, and Reed also has 1,438 return yards as opposed to Polamalu’s 328. In forced fumbles/fumble recoveries, Reed also has the lead with 10:7, compared to 8:4 for Polamalu.

Who was better Troy Polamalu or Ed Reed?

Polamalu won that honor in 2010. Both were All-Pro regulars. In 158 regular-season games, Polamalu produced 770 tackles, 32 interceptions and 14 forced fumbles. In 174 regular-season games, Reed delivered 643 tackles, 64 interceptions and 11 forced fumbles.

How many touchdowns did Ed Reed score?

In all, Reed played 174 career games and amassed a total of 643 tackles (531 solo), intercepted 64 passes which he returned for 1,590 yards and 7 touchdowns, recorded 6 sacks, and made 13 fumble recoveries. A nine-time Pro Bowler, Reed was named All-Pro six times and the NFL Defensive Player of the Year in 2004.

What does a free safety do?

The free safety tends to watch the play unfold and follow the ball as well as be the “defensive quarterback” of the backfield. … On pass plays, the free safety is expected to assist the cornerback on his side and to close the distance to the receiver by the time the ball reaches him.

Who threw the most interceptions in one season?

The record for most interceptions in a single season is held by Night Train Lane, who logged 14 interceptions as a rookie in 1952, while playing for the Los Angeles Rams. Previously Dan Sandifer of Washington and Spec Sanders jointly held the record, earning 13 interceptions, in 1948 and 1950, respectively.
